Fife Voluntary Action is excited to announce the recruitment of three part-time Lived Experience Team (LET) Facilitators to support the Mental Health and Wellbeing in Primary Care Services (MHWPCS) programme. This programme aims to shape and improve local mental health and wellbeing services by drawing on the local knowledge, skills, and experiences of people who use, deliver, and commission services.
Essentially, we are looking for three new staff members to help us reach out to and engage with people who use services to work alongside staff to recommend improvements to mental health and wellbeing services in our communities.
Successful applicants will work flexibly, including occasional evenings or weekends, to support this.
Training on co-production, commissioning, and using Zoom/Teams will be provided, as will ongoing support and guidance from our LET Co-ordinator. To find out more about the LET, please click here.
